Seiko Kicks off their 145th Anniversary Year with Four Limited Editions
Seiko is celebrating its 145th anniversary by launching four limited-edition watches across its King Seiko, Prospex, Presage, and Astron collections. Each model incorporates gold accents while maintaining Seiko’s signature balance of form and function. The King Seiko features a grey gradient dial inspired by founder Kintaro Hattori, while the Prospex honors the brand's chronograph history, resembling classic designs from the 60s and 70s. The Presage takes cues from the Timekeeper pocket watch, offering a blend of traditional and modern elements, and the Astron showcases advanced technology with GPS connectivity and a sleek black-coated titanium case. These limited editions reflect Seiko's commitment to honoring its history while innovating for contemporary needs. With prices ranging from $1,900 to $3,300, each watch is designed to appeal to both collectors and enthusiasts alike, illustrating the brand's evolution over 145 years.
